Turkey received assistance from 21 countries in the European Union, while only a few provided assistance to Syria

There is a clear politicization by the West in delivering humanitarian aid to Syria, Russian Foreign Ministry Spokeswoman Maria Zakharova said at press conference on Friday.

“There is clear politicization by the West in delivering humanitarian aid to Syria, as Turkey received assistance from 21 countries in the European Union, while only a few provided assistance to Syria, which is unacceptable in the humanitarian field,” Zakharova said.

Rendering emergency humanitarian assistance to Syria is a priority, given the destruction caused by the earthquake, the Russian diplomats indicated.

“We stress the importance of lifting unilateral restrictions from Syria to simplify relief efforts,” Zakharova added.

Russia will continue to provide humanitarian assistance for the quake- affected people in Syria, adding that the Russian rescuers returned from Syria after completing the search-and-rescue operation in the earthquake- affected area, Zakharova said.
